Why are you dressed in items that have nothing to say or do with you? Start to dress for you and state your path via your wardrobe.

Embrace your body. Love your story.
Connect with you body.
When we dress like someone else, we already instil a deep sense of detachment and abandonment of the self.
Mark your intentions. Put thought into the clothes that go on your back.
Clothes are charged in huge narrative and meaning. They have the power to project colour and vibrancy into your day - and to lift you into the present moment.
Notice the textures of your clothes. How do they feel on your skin and what values and intentions seem to rise up when dressed in that outfit.
Start to dress consciously, start to be selective and only wear what reflects who you are and what you stand for. When we dress like someone else we already instil a sense of detachment and abandonment of the self.

By wearing clothes that reflect you, you already offer an embrace and show love for you. Get to know your body, your curves, your shape and start to select items that connect and define you.
Start to approach you wardrobe like a palette you are dipping into - use it to tint or contour who you are. Clothes are a symbol and a language. Once you understand their power, make real time to choose what you wear.
You might even start to take joy in truly accepting your body, your history and the path you are taking. As each item carries an essence of you, your passions and values.
